Hi Marc,
Am 2014-07-11 14:09, schrieb Marc Kleine-Budde:
> IMHO it should be 4 seperate patches:
> - dt
> - clocks
> - flexcan_get_berr_counter fixes
> - your flexcan enhancements
Ok, will split.
>> @@ -362,7 +374,7 @@
>>
>> esdhc1: esdhc@400b2000 {
>> compatible = "fsl,imx53-esdhc";
>> - reg = <0x400b2000 0x4000>;
>> + reg = <0x400b2000 0x1000>;
>
> What's that doing here? :)
That's an error I just stumbled upon. I know it's not related but it's
such a small change... Do I need to make a separate patch for that or
can I include it in the FlexCAN dt commit?
>> @@ -150,18 +171,20 @@
>> * FLEXCAN hardware feature flags
>> *
>> * Below is some version info we got:
>> - * SOC Version IP-Version Glitch- [TR]WRN_INT
>> - * Filter? connected?
>> - * MX25 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 no no
>> - * MX28 FlexCAN2 03.00.04.00 yes yes
>> - * MX35 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 no no
>> - * MX53 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 yes no
>> - * MX6s FlexCAN3 10.00.12.00 yes yes
>> + * SOC Version IP-Version Glitch- [TR]WRN_INT Memory err
>> + * Filter? connected? detection
>> + * MX25 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 no no no
>> + * MX28 FlexCAN2 03.00.04.00 yes yes no
>> + * MX35 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 no no no
>> + * MX53 FlexCAN2 03.00.00.00 yes no no
>> + * MX6s FlexCAN3 10.00.12.00 yes yes no
>> + * VFxx FlexCAN3 ? no no yes
>
> Please use either tabs or space to indent in this table.
Ok, btw, do you know how I can obtain the IP version?
--
Stefan
